Malus โIndian Magicโ is a variety of Crab Apple noted for its vibrant colours and persistent fruit which last well into the Winter months. Mid-green leaves appear in Spring with a tinge of bronze, followed by small dark pink buds which bloom into beautiful, single pink flowers with a light fragrance. Nearer to Autumn small, berry-like crab apples appear on the branches in hues of glossy oranges and reds. A generally hardy and disease resistant breed which, like most crab apples, is a great choice for jam making.
Plant in moist, well-drained soil and keep in full sun. Drought tolerant once established. Self-fertile, requiring no other trees nearby to produce fruit though cross pollination yields the best results.
